Output bf3dc86ee26df5802f2a1c3637134d43fc5aedd826d19609ba588723ab529a58:0

value
28723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65ceca29d317c7486383a893bff19ef3779995df OP_EQUAL
address
3AyKtvFVe2bUrZ8uk8wNiBsMTXLQpPPeWK
transaction
bf3dc86ee26df5802f2a1c3637134d43fc5aedd826d19609ba588723ab529a58
confirmations
195582
spent
true